Position: Principal / Associate Asset Management Consultant

Overview

At AtkinsRéalis we offer an opportunity to make a difference and shape the world to benefit future generations and the natural environment. Our Infrastructure Division supports many major infrastructure programmes across the UK and internationally, delivering effective outcomes by optimising performance of new and existing assets. Our Infrastructure Asset Management Practice is a key component, ensuring customers' outcomes are realised and delivering bespoke sector‑specific solutions to optimise asset performance.

AtkinsRéalis offers the opportunity to influence significant infrastructure programmes in the UK and implement innovative solutions across the sector.

Our Services Include
  • Our Infrastructure Asset & Information Management practice delivers data‑driven solutions as well as providing asset management, regulatory, and technical advice to a range of clients, both in the UK and internationally. We are looking for an enthusiastic, client and solution‑oriented individual to lead and develop our asset performance business with our clients.
  • Asset performance monitoring and benchmarking, including use/development of dashboards and digital tools to drive improved performance. Strategic Planning including development of risk‑based decision‑making tools and methodologies, and prioritisation.
  • Tactical Planning. Turning Business Plans into reality and delivering outcomes.
  • Assurance and regulatory advice both for UK Water utilities and internationally.
  • Strategic Asset Management advice, including gap analysis and improvement plans against ISO
    55001/ business process engineering, business plan development.
  • The role is to lead Asset Management Projects and provide Asset Management Leadership for some of our significant strategic projects. You will be a key member of our Infrastructure Asset Management Practice which seeks to support our key clients in the Aviation Market. We are looking for an energetic individual with proven ability to sell this expertise and then build and co‑ordinate a team to deliver solutions.
Your role

Candidates should have a blend of technical, stakeholder engagement, financial, and project management skills to win and deliver projects:

  • Possess a background in winning and serving clients on major projects, a sound technical background, excellent communication and organisational skills and thorough knowledge and understanding of aviation clients.
  • Participate in strategic planning for aviation to maximise profitability, marketing capabilities, operational efficiencies, and quality.
  • Leverage existing and develop new aviation client relationships to identify and pursue business opportunities.
  • Assist in the development of project work plans; participates in reviews of schedules, budgets, project milestone dates and work products.
  • Participate in the development of the annual and strategic plans for the area of responsibility and implements accordingly.
  • Actively pursue new project opportunities for the area of responsibility by maintaining contacts with current and prospective clients.
  • Participates in the evaluation of new project opportunities for the area of responsibility.
  • Identify and work toward the resolution of client relations problems.
About You

Candidates for this role must be open to UK and potentially international travel and periods away from their home office on a regular basis.

  • Proven track record in applying digital asset management including advanced analytical techniques to improve business performance and addressing client challenges.
  • A confident, professional manner with a "Can Do" approach.
  • Strong communication skills, able to explain complex matters to clients and internal stakeholders in a clear and relevant way.
  • Commercially astute.
  • A supportive and encouraging approach to identifying and nurturing talent.
  • Ability to work collaboratively within AtkinsRéalis, with the supply chain and with Clients.
Qualifications
  • Honours Degree or equivalent in a relevant discipline.
  • Asset Management Qualifications, preferred but not essential.
  • Membership of an appropriate professional body preferred but not essential.
